Core Refusal Reason
The proposed development represents overdevelopment of a constrained site that would be injurious to residential amenities and compromise public safety due to a haphazard layout and inadequate environmental controls.
Decision Maker's Conclusion
- The intensification of commercial activity and the scale of the new building would negatively impact the residential amenities of adjacent dwellings through increased noise and disruption.
- The proposed site layout is considered haphazard and would lead to conflicts between vehicular and pedestrian movements, thereby compromising public safety.
- The development is facilitated by the unauthorized use of an adjacent site for parking and fails to demonstrate compliance with sustainable urban drainage standards regarding petrol interception.

Decision Document Summary
This application by N Smith and Sons LTD proposed the demolition of a car wash and the construction of a new commercial vehicle (CRV) testing centre at an established car dealership on North Road, Drogheda. Although the site has an established non-conforming use, it is zoned A1 'Existing Residential' under the Louth County Development Plan 2021-2027.
